はじめに
みんな、元気にしてるか?今日は「YEARFRAC」っていう関数を一緒に学んでいこうな!この関数は、日付の差を年単位で計算してくれる便利なもんやで。
YEARFRAC関数の一般的な使い方の例
たとえば、ある日付から別の日付までの期間が何年か知りたいときに使うんや。例えば、2020年1月1日から2023年10月1日までの期間を調べたいとするやろ?そんときは、以下のように使うんや。
=YEARFRAC("2020/1/1", "2023/10/1")
これを入力すると、約3.75年って出てくるんや。つまり、3年と9ヶ月ぐらいの期間ってことやな。
「YEARFRAC」この関数を学ぶメリット
この関数を学ぶことで、いろんなシーンで役立つで!例えば、投資の利回りを計算したり、仕事のプロジェクトの期間を年単位で把握したり、さらには借金の返済期間を計算するのにも使えるんや。要するに、ビジネスやプライベートでの計画がスムーズに進むようになるってことやな!
これから一緒にこの「YEARFRAC」をマスターして、日付の計算を楽にしていこうや!
YEARFRAC関数の基本構文
さてさて、次は「YEARFRAC」関数の基本構文についてお話しするで!これを理解したら、もっとスムーズに使えるようになるから、しっかりついてきてな!
YEARFRAC関数の定義と主な引数
「YEARFRAC」関数の基本的な構文はこんな感じやで:
YEARFRAC(start_date, end_date, [basis])
- start_date: 期間の始まりの日付や。ここには日付を指定せなあかんで。
- end_date: 期間の終わりの日付や。これも日付を指定するんや。
- [basis]: これはオプションやけど、日数計算の方法を指定する引数や。デフォルトは「0」で、これは「実日数/実日数」を意味するんや。他にもいくつかの選択肢があるから、必要に応じて使い分けてな。
YEARFRAC関数の返す結果とその特性
この「YEARFRAC」関数が返す結果は、日付の差を年単位の小数で表すもんや。例えば、1.5って出たら、1年と6ヶ月ってことやな。また、出てくる小数点以下の数字も大事や。これによって、期間の詳細な部分も分かるようになってるんや。
特に、金融やビジネスの計算では、この小数が重要になってくるから、しっかり理解しておくとええで!これを使いこなせれば、日付に関する計算がめっちゃ楽になるから、ぜひ覚えてや!
YEARFRAC関数・具体的な使用例
よっしゃ!次は「YEARFRAC」関数の具体的な使用例を見ていくで。これを知ることで、実際の場面でどう使うかが分かるから、しっかりと押さえておいてな!
基本的な使用方法のデモ
まずは、基本的な使い方をもう一度おさらいするで。例えば、2021年3月15日から2023年11月1日までの期間を計算したいとするやろ?その場合は、こんな感じで入力するんや。
=YEARFRAC("2021/3/15", "2023/11/1")
これを実行すると、約2.6って出てくるで。つまり、約2年と7ヶ月ってことや。シンプルやろ?
YEARFRAC関数一般的な計算や操作の例
次に、もう少し複雑な例を見てみよう。たとえば、あるプロジェクトの開始日が2020年6月10日で、終了日が2023年4月25日やったとする。この場合、プロジェクトの期間を求めたいときは、次のように書くんや。
=YEARFRAC("2020/6/10", "2023/4/25")
これを実行すると、約2.9って出てくるで。つまり、2年と11ヶ月ぐらいの期間ってことになるな。
さらに、もし「basis」を使いたい場合、例えば「1」を指定すると、日数を360日で計算する方法になるんや。こんな感じやで:
=YEARFRAC("2020/6/10", "2023/4/25", 1)
これによって、計算結果が変わることもあるから、必要に応じて使い分けてな!
このように「YEARFRAC」関数を使えば、簡単に年単位の期間を計算できるから、ぜひ活用してみてや!
初歩的なテクニック
お待たせしました!今度は「YEARFRAC」関数の簡単な使い方やコツ、さらに他の基本関数との組み合わせについてお話しするで!これを知っとけば、スプレッドシートの使い方がもっと楽しくなるから、頑張ってついてきてな!
【YEARFRAC関数】簡単な使い方やコツ
まず、「YEARFRAC」関数を使うときのコツやけど、日付は正しいフォーマットで入力することが大事やで。例えば、”YYYY/MM/DD”の形式を守ると、エラーが出にくくなるから安心や。
それから、日付を直接入力するんじゃなくて、セルを参照するのもええ方法やで。例えば、A1に開始日、B1に終了日が入ってるとしたら、こんなふうに書けるんや。
=YEARFRAC(A1, B1)
この方法やと、日付を変更したときに自動で計算結果も変わるから、すごく便利や!
他の基本関数との組み合わせ
「YEARFRAC」関数は、他の関数とも組み合わせて使えるんやで。例えば、計算した年数を四捨五入したいときには、「ROUND」関数と一緒に使うとええ。
=ROUND(YEARFRAC("2020/1/1", "2023/10/1"), 0)
これやと、計算結果が整数で表示されるから、見やすくなるな。
また、「IF」関数と組み合わせることで、特定の条件に応じた計算ができるようになるで。例えば、2年以上の場合に「長期プロジェクト」と表示したいときは、こんなふうに書けるんや。
=IF(YEARFRAC("2020/1/1", "2023/10/1") > 2, "長期プロジェクト", "短期プロジェクト")
これで、プロジェクトの期間に応じたメッセージが表示されるから、情報が整理されて便利やな!
このように「YEARFRAC」関数を使いこなすことで、スプレッドシートでの計算がもっと楽しくなるで!ぜひ、いろんな組み合わせを試して、自分なりの使い方を見つけてみてや!
便利なシーンでの事例
さて、次は「YEARFRAC」関数を使った便利なシーンの事例を紹介するで!ビジネスや学業での実用的なケーススタディを通じて、どんなふうに使えるかを見ていこう。
ビジネスや学業での実用的なケーススタディ
例えば、ある企業で新しいプロジェクトを始めるとき、プロジェクトの開始日と終了日をもとに期間を計算せなあかんことがあるやろ。これに「YEARFRAC」関数を使うと、すぐに期間を把握できるから、スケジュール管理に役立つで。
例えば、プロジェクトの開始日が2022年5月1日で、終了日が2023年7月15日やったとする。この場合、次のように計算するんや。
=YEARFRAC("2022/5/1", "2023/7/15")
これで、約1.19年、つまり約1年と2ヶ月の期間が求められるから、具体的なスケジュールを立てる際に役立つんや。
また、大学の授業で、特定の課題の提出までの期間を計算することもできるで。例えば、課題の提出日が2023年11月30日で、今が2023年10月1日やったとしたら、次のように使える。
=YEARFRAC("2023/10/1", "2023/11/30")
これで、約0.09年、つまり約27日間の余裕があるとわかるから、計画的に課題を進められるな!
「YEARFRAC関数」タイムセーブや効率向上の具体的な例
これらの例からもわかるように、「YEARFRAC」関数を使うことで、時間の計算が一瞬で終わるから、タイムセーブにもつながるで。特に、複数のプロジェクトや課題を同時に管理しとるときには、計算の手間を省けるのが大きなメリットやな。
例えば、プロジェクトが複数あるとき、各プロジェクトの開始日と終了日をリストに並べて、全てに対して「YEARFRAC」関数を使うことで、すぐにそれぞれの期間を把握できる。これによって、プロジェクトごとの進捗状況をひと目で確認できるから、効率がグッと上がるで!
また、複数の課題の提出日を管理する際も、同じように活用できる。これによって、優先順位をつけやすくなるから、学業でも効率的にタスクを進められるようになるな。
このように、「YEARFRAC」関数を活用することで、ビジネスや学業の場面でのタイムセーブや効率向上が図れるから、ぜひ積極的に使ってみてや!
YEARFRAC関数の類似の関数や代替の関数との違い
さあ、ここでは「YEARFRAC」関数と似たような役割を持つ関数、その違いについて話していくで!どんな関数があって、どう使い分けるかを知ることで、スプレッドシートの活用がもっと広がるから、しっかりと押さえておいてな!
1. DATEDIF関数
最初に紹介するのは「DATEDIF」関数や。この関数は、2つの日付の間の年数、月数、日数を計算するもので、使い方も簡単やで。例えば、開始日が2021年1月1日で、終了日が2023年11月1日やったとしたら、次のように使う。
=DATEDIF("2021/1/1", "2023/11/1", "Y")
この「Y」を指定すると、年数だけが返されるんや。もし、月数が欲しかったら「M」を使うし、日数が欲しかったら「D」を使うとええ。つまり、期間を細かく分けて確認したいときに便利やな!
違い: 「YEARFRAC」は年数を小数で返して、より細かい期間を知りたいときに使えるけど、「DATEDIF」は年数、月数、日数を分けて取得できるから、用途に応じて使い分けるのがポイントやで。
2. NETWORKDAYS関数
次に「NETWORKDAYS」関数や。これは、開始日から終了日までの営業日数を計算するための関数や。例えば、2023年10月1日から2023年10月31日までの営業日数を計算したいときは、次のように書くんや。
=NETWORKDAYS("2023/10/1", "2023/10/31")
これで、営業日数が出てくるから、ビジネスシーンでの納期管理やスケジュール調整に役立つで。
違い: 「YEARFRAC」は年数の計算をするけど、「NETWORKDAYS」は営業日数を計算する関数やから、目的が全然違うんや。特に、プロジェクトの進捗管理や納期を考えるときには「NETWORKDAYS」が重宝するで。
3. YEAR関数とMONTH関数
最後に、シンプルな「YEAR」関数と「MONTH」関数も紹介するで。これらの関数は、それぞれ日付から年や月を抽出するもんや。例えば、日付がA1セルに入っているとしたら、年を取り出すにはこうする。
=YEAR(A1)
月を取り出すにはこんなふうに書くんや。
=MONTH(A1)
違い: これらの関数は日付から特定の要素だけを取り出すから、「YEARFRAC」のように期間を計算するのとは別物や。特定の年や月を知りたいときには、こっちの関数が役立つな!
このように、「YEARFRAC」関数と類似の関数、代替の関数にはそれぞれ特徴があるから、目的に応じて使い分けることが大切やで!スプレッドシートを使いこなすために、ぜひ色んな関数を試してみてな!
まとめと次のステップ
さて、ここまで「YEARFRAC」関数についてしっかり学んできたな!最後に、この関数を効果的に利用するためのベストプラクティスと、さらに学ぶためのリソースを紹介するで。
YEARFRAC関数を効果的に利用するためのベストプラクティス
-
日付のフォーマットを統一する: 日付を入力する際は、必ず同じフォーマット(たとえば「YYYY/MM/DD」)を使うことが大事や。これでエラーを減らせるで。
-
セル参照を活用する: 日付を直接入力するんじゃなくて、セルを参照することで、データが変更されたときに自動で計算結果も変わるから便利やで。たとえば、A1に開始日、B1に終了日を入れておくといいんや。
-
他の関数との組み合わせを試す: 「YEARFRAC」関数を他の関数(たとえば「ROUND」や「IF」)と組み合わせることで、より複雑な計算や条件分岐ができるから、ぜひ挑戦してみてな。
-
定期的に確認する: プロジェクトや課題の進捗を定期的に確認し、計算結果を見直すことで、スケジュール管理がスムーズになるで。
関連リソースやさらなる学習のための推奨
-
Google スプレッドシートのヘルプセンター: Googleの公式ヘルプセンターには、関数の使い方が詳しく説明されてるから、ぜひ参考にしてみてな。特に「YEARFRAC」関数のページを見てみると、具体例や使い方が載ってるで。
-
YouTubeチュートリアル: スプレッドシートの使い方についての動画もたくさんあるから、視覚で学ぶのも効果的や。特に「スプレッドシート 関数」などのキーワードで検索してみると、役立つ動画が見つかるで!
-
オンラインコース: CourseraやUdemyなどのプラットフォームでは、スプレッドシートの使い方を学べるコースがたくさんあるから、自分のペースで学ぶことができるで。
-
コミュニティフォーラム: スプレッドシートに関する質問や情報交換ができるフォーラムやQ&Aサイト(例えば、Stack Overflow)も活用してみてな。疑問があったら、他のユーザーの知恵を借りるのもええ手やで。
これで「YEARFRAC」関数のまとめはおしまいや!この知識を活かして、スプレッドシートをもっと使いこなしていってな。次のステップに進む準備ができたら、楽しんで学んでいこう!頑張ってや!
【YEARFRAC関数】プロジェクト管理や課題計算に役立つ!簡単な使い方と実用サンプルコードを紹介!